Sha256: a78fd4bb933bad54e3340eb9e79493aeeaebbc438229771f878b20ce5eb10241

Contents?: true

Size: 462 Bytes

Versions: 8

Compression:

Stored size: 462 Bytes

Contents

# TypeProf 0.21.2

# Classes
module Yuuki
  module Runner
    def periodic: (Symbol method, Integer interval) -> void
    def first_run: (Symbol method, ?enabled: bool) -> void
  end

  class PeriodicCaller < Caller
    @on_error: Proc

    attr_reader first_run: bool
    attr_reader current_time: Float
    def initialize: (*untyped instances) -> void
    def on_error: {(Exception) -> void} -> void
    def run: (?Integer gmtoff, **untyped) -> void
  end
end

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
yuuki-0.1.10 sig/yuuki/periodic.rbs
yuuki-0.1.9 sig/yuuki/periodic.rbs
yuuki-0.1.8 sig/yuuki/periodic.rbs
yuuki-0.1.7 sig/yuuki/periodic.rbs
yuuki-0.1.5 sig/yuuki/periodic.rbs
yuuki-0.1.4 sig/yuuki/periodic.rbs
yuuki-0.1.3 sig/yuuki/periodic.rbs
yuuki-0.1.2 sig/yuuki/periodic.rbs